Creating notes by accident while in call

Anyone else have a problem with the phone making a note while you are on the phone? I don't think my screen turns off since half the time when I get off the phone my screen shows a doodle from my face in a note! I have the Verizon Touch Pro, and I'm not sure if this is just this phone or all Touch Pros, but anyone else have this problem or have a fix for this?

It maybe is caused to you pulling out the stylus during a phone call. Settings/phone/advanced will turn that off.

Quick fix for me was to remember to hit the power button once on top of the device. Doing so while making or taking a call turns off the screen. Pulling out the stylus while on a call, activates the notes application.

There's a great program developed over a at XDA called Touchlockpro1.5 that works WONDERS for locking the device when in your pocket as well. There's another thread started for it here.
